All design patterns implemented in Java with code, explanation and learning resources
-
Updated
Sep 27, 2021 - Java
Software Engineering is the discipline of applying engineering principles and practices to the creation, maintenance, and design of software for a variety of applications. This topic covers a broad range of areas including requirements analysis, software design, programming, project management, testing, and maintenance. It emphasizes systematic, disciplined, and quantifiable approaches to the successful development of high-quality, reliable software systems.
All design patterns implemented in Java with code, explanation and learning resources
System design not just on whiteboard, but with code.
🛒 A sales app clone built in Android Studio with SQLite backend
A program that has full functionality for a course registration system for Marmara University.
My solutions to Homeworks from PennX: SD2x Data Structures and Software Design course
design-patterns
Movie Recommendations like Netflix, Amezon Prime
The final project for CIS 245 at MCCC. This is a simulation of a railway management system.
Finding Apartment and Roommate Search (Android application that helps university students to find for roommates to rent out their rooms or allows potential student look for a renter)
Final project of the Object Oriented Programming discipline of my Undergraduate course.
Clean Architecture and Domain Driven Design project - Advanced SWE @ Cooperative State University (DHBW)
📋 Projeto da disciplina de Design de Software do curso de Engenharia de Software INF-UFG.
Multi-tenant REST API that persists data in different databases
A collection of projects specified in the PennEngineering Extension School's Data Structures and Software Design course.
It contains explain and example of various Design Pattern
Design patterns implemented in Java.
Learn how to apply design principles, patterns, and architectures to create reusable, flexible, and maintainable software applications and systems.
A desktop application that offers seniors many features grouped into modules such as pharmacy management, contacts, calendar and a reminder section of prayer time.
Created by Software engineers